What a 4-point inspection covers
A 4-point inspection documents the condition and age of the four systems Florida insurance carriers consider highest-risk. Each system is evaluated and included in a written report formatted for insurer submission.
Roof
Age, condition, and materials. Jupiter's older coastal communities and Intracoastal neighborhoods have roofs from the 1970s and 1980s that insurers flag closely. Coastal salt air and UV exposure accelerate wear even on tile roofs — the inspection documents what the carrier needs to evaluate coverage.
Electrical
Panel type, breaker condition, and visible wiring. Aluminum wiring and certain older panel brands may require remediation before coverage is issued. Older Palm Beach County homes may have panels or wiring that trigger insurer review.
Plumbing
Supply and drain line materials and water heater age. Polybutylene piping or aging galvanized lines commonly trigger insurer scrutiny. The inspection documents what your insurer needs to approve coverage.
HVAC
Age, condition, and operation of heating and cooling equipment. Jupiter's subtropical climate means HVAC systems run nearly year-round; coastal salt air further accelerates wear on outdoor condenser units. Aging units in older neighborhoods are among the most commonly flagged items by Florida insurers.
Why Jupiter homeowners need a 4-point inspection
Jupiter has housing stock across a wide age range — older coastal and Intracoastal communities from the 1960s through the 1980s broadly exceed the 25-year threshold Florida insurers apply for 4-point documentation, and Abacoa homes from the late 1990s are at or approaching it. Without the report, carriers may delay, condition, or decline coverage. Jupiter's coastal exposure adds additional insurer scrutiny — the report gives your carrier what it needs to evaluate the property.
